Iminsi myiza

🌍 Burundi
Added August 06, 2025
TOP DEFINITION
Iminsi myiza (Good days)
"Tugire iminsi myiza (May we have good days)"
by Khulekani Dladla August 06, 2025
0
Iminsi myiza (Good days/holidays)
"Iminsi myiza y'ikiruhuko (Good vacation days)"
by Khulekani Dladla August 06, 2025
0